Peruvian ambassador honours IPRA President for 2015

At a ceremony in London attended by peers and the IPRA Board, Minister Daniel Roca on behalf of Ambassador to the Court of St James's Julio Muñoz-Deacon participated in the inauguration of IPRA's new President for 2015, Dr Amybel Sánchez de Walther.

In her speech of acceptance, Dr Sanchez recognised the heritage of IPRA and how some things remain constant in today's ultra-connected world: "I am IPRA's 51st President, in an organisation, which spans six decades. Two things remain key: education and information. The former is related to our own academic achievements and the latter nourishes our daily professional practice in the field and in the office."

The International Public Relations Association (IPRA) will also be hosting its World Congress in South Africa in 2015 and choosing Johannesburg as their preferred venue following a successful bid from Joburg Tourism.

The congress is due to take place at the Sandton Convention Centre, with the expected number of delegates to be in the region of 500 - perhaps more - from all over the world. The date has been finalised for the 27-29 of September 2015.
